    Abstract: A multiple distributed system is disclosed. An uplink control resource allocation method for a user equipment to transmit an Acknowledgement/Negative ACK (ACK/NACK) signal includes receiving one or more Enhanced-Physical Downlink Control Channels (E-PDCCHs), receiving one or more Physical Downlink Shared Channels (PDSCHs) corresponding to the one or more E-PDCCHs, and transmitting ACK/NACK signals for reception of the one or more PDSCHs through a Physical Uplink Control Channel (PUCCH), wherein Control Channel Element (CCE) indexes of the PUCCH transmitting the ACK/NACK signals are determined in consideration of first CCE indexes of the one or more E-PDCCHs and the number of CCEs of a PUCCH determined by a higher layer.

    Abstract: The present invention relates to a wireless communication system, and more particularly, to a method and apparatus for transceiving a downlink control channel. According to one embodiment of the present invention, method in which a base station transmits downlink control information in a wireless communication system comprises: a step for determining an allocatable resource region for an enhanced physical downlink control channel (E-PDCCH) of a local allocation system; a step for allocating an E-PDCCH to the determined allocatable resource region for the E-PDCCH; and a step for transmitting the downlink control information on the allocated E-PDCCH. The allocatable resource region for the E-PDCCH can be set as a group of partial resource regions in each of a plurality of partitions when a downlink system bandwidth contains said plurality of partitions.

    Abstract: An embodiment of the present invention relates to a method in which a terminal receives control information in a wireless communication system, said method comprising: a step of performing blind decoding in at least one portion of a resource region except the time unit indicated by a physical control format indicator channel (PCFICH) on a subframe, said at least one portion of the resource region is determined by whether a synchronizing signal or system information is transmitted or not.

    Abstract: The present invention relates to a wireless access system supporting a full duplex radio (FDR) transmission environment, various signal transmission methods for preventing a loss of control information due to uplink-downlink interference during FDR transmission, a method for constructing a frame structure and an apparatus for supporting the same. A method for configuring a frame structure in a wireless access system supporting FDR transmission according to one embodiment of the present invention may comprise the steps of: negotiating whether to support FDR transmission; allocating, to a predetermined subframe, a downlink control channel and a downlink data channel; allocating, to a predetermined subframe, an uplink data channel for FDR transmission; nulling a resource area of the uplink data channel corresponding to the downlink control channel and allocating the resource area to an empty area; and transmitting resource allocation information about a predetermined subframe, wherein the uplink transmission and the downlink transmission for FDR transmission in a predetermined subframe can be simultaneously performed in the same area.

    Abstract: The present invention relates to a wireless communication system, and more specifically, disclosed are a method and an apparatus for reporting channel status information. A method for reporting the channel status information (CSI) from a user equipment in the wireless communication system, according to one embodiment of the present invention, comprises the steps of: receiving from a base station a channel status information-reference signal (CSI-RS) on the basis of CSI-RS configuration information, which is provided from the base station; and reporting to the base station the CSI that is generated by using the CSI-RS, wherein the CSI-RS configuration information can include a plurality of CSI-RS configurations with respect to a first domain antenna group having a 2-dimensional antenna structure of the base station.

    Abstract: An embodiment of the present invention relates to a method in which a base station transmits a signal in a wireless communication system, said method comprising: a step of allocating downlink control information to either a first slot or a second slot of a subframe; a step of allocating data related to said downlink control information to the slot to which said downlink control information is allocated; and a step of transmitting the subframe including said downlink control information and said data. The downlink control information is allocated to one or more resource block, and the data is allocated to the slot paired with the slot to which the downlink control information is allocated.

    Abstract: The present invention relates to a wireless communication system, and more particularly, to a method and apparatus for transceiving a downlink control channel. According to one embodiment of the present invention, a method in which a base station transmits a downlink control channel to a terminal in a wireless communication system comprises the steps of: transmitting one or more enhanced-physical downlink control channels (E-PDCCHs) within a resource region allocable for an E-PDCCH; and transmitting E-PDCCH allocation resource information for the one or more E-PDCCHs to the terminal. The E-PDCCH allocation resource information indicates the resource in which the one or more E-PDCCHs exist from among the resource region allocable to the E-PDCCH. An effective physical downlink shared channel (PDSCH) allocation resource region for the terminal can be determined on the basis of the E-PDCCH allocation resource information.
